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
035878909 73475127825 2623 62 24
918 243970739 0966561890
918 243970739 0966561890
342 642818 1614476 1615509 57528582171
All about undefined
Interested in learning more?
918 243970739 0966561890
342 642818 1614476 1615509 57528582171
See more
0995227 0095639
90970262 760 1838948 532635
See more
43615467581 1661388 68
01 946 6402678850
See more